MLX-Flash exposes a Prometheus-compatible /metrics endpoint on both the Rust proxy (:8080) and Python workers (:8081+). All metrics use the mlx_flash_ prefix.
# 1. Start MLX-Flash
mlx-flash --port 8080 --workers 2
# 2. Verify metrics
curl http://localhost:8080/metrics
# 3. Start Grafana + Prometheus (auto-provisioned)
docker compose --profile monitoring up -d
# 4. Open Grafana
open http://localhost:3000 # admin / mlxflashThe pre-built dashboard is auto-loaded at startup.

These metrics come from macOS kernel memory statistics via host_statistics64() and sysctl. They reflect the physical RAM state of the Mac running inference — critical for understanding whether your model fits in memory or is swap-thrashing.
| Metric | Type | Unit | Description |
|---|---|---|---|
mlx_flash_memory_total_bytes |
gauge | bytes | Total physical RAM installed. |
mlx_flash_memory_free_bytes |
gauge | bytes | Free (completely unused) pages. |
mlx_flash_memory_available_bytes |
gauge | bytes | Usable RAM: free + 50% × inactive. Best single indicator. |
mlx_flash_memory_active_bytes |
gauge | bytes | Active pages (recently accessed, not evictable). |
mlx_flash_memory_inactive_bytes |
gauge | bytes | Inactive pages (reclaimable under pressure). |
mlx_flash_memory_wired_bytes |
gauge | bytes | Wired pages (kernel, not evictable). |
mlx_flash_memory_compressed_bytes |
gauge | bytes | Compressed pages (in-memory compression). |
mlx_flash_memory_swap_used_bytes |
gauge | bytes | Swap space currently in use. Non-zero = performance degradation. |
mlx_flash_memory_used_ratio |
gauge | ratio (0-1) | 1 - available / total. Alert if > 0.85. |
mlx_flash_memory_pressure |
gauge | enum | macOS pressure level: 0=normal, 1=warning, 2=critical. |
Key metric for alerting: mlx_flash_memory_pressure > 0 means macOS is actively reclaiming pages. At 2 (critical), inference latency will spike due to page eviction and swap I/O.

The Rust proxy polls each Python worker's /status endpoint and exposes their stats as Prometheus metrics. Only one scrape target needed (:8080).
| Metric | Type | Labels | Description |
|---|---|---|---|
mlx_flash_python_worker_tokens_total |
counter | worker (port), model |
Tokens generated by this Python worker. |
mlx_flash_python_worker_requests_total |
counter | worker (port), model |
Requests handled by this Python worker. |
mlx_flash_python_worker_uptime_seconds |
gauge | worker (port), model |
Worker uptime in seconds. |
mlx_flash_python_worker_memory_pressure |
gauge | worker (port) |
Worker's macOS memory pressure (0/1/2). |
mlx_flash_python_worker_model_loaded |
gauge | worker (port), model |
1 if model loaded, 0 if pending. |

# Request rate (req/s)
rate(mlx_flash_requests_total[1m])
# Token generation rate (tok/s)
rate(mlx_flash_tokens_generated_total[1m])
# Average tokens per request
rate(mlx_flash_tokens_generated_total[5m]) / rate(mlx_flash_requests_total[5m])
# Memory used percentage
mlx_flash_memory_used_ratio * 100
# Available RAM in GB
mlx_flash_memory_available_bytes / 1073741824
# Worker load imbalance (max inflight across workers)
max(mlx_flash_worker_inflight) - min(mlx_flash_worker_inflight)
# Per-worker request rate
rate(mlx_flash_worker_requests_total[1m])
# Any worker down?
mlx_flash_workers_total - mlx_flash_workers_healthy > 0
# Cache miss rate
rate(mlx_flash_cache_misses_total[5m]) / (rate(mlx_flash_cache_hits_total[5m]) + rate(mlx_flash_cache_misses_total[5m]))
# Swap is active (bad for inference)
mlx_flash_memory_swap_used_bytes > 0
